Important Clarification for HSA Contribution Reporting on W-2 Forms

With tax time upon us, we wanted to send a reminder for employers who have a Health Savings Account (HSA) regarding their contribution reporting.  Whether you complete your own W-2s or use a payroll service, you will want to ensure that all employer contributions made to an employee’s HSA are recorded on the employee’s W-2 in Box 12 with Code “W”.  This is described on page 6 of the W-2 instructions on the IRS website (click here for more details).  Furthermore, this figure should also include amounts the employee contributed to the HSA through a section 125 cafeteria plan (explained on page 13 of the W-2 instructions).
